    Tesla PPF Installation Guide: Step-by-Step Process

    Applying paint protection film to your Tesla vehicle can be a straightforward process, but it does require some preparation and attention to detail. In this section, we’ll walk you through the necessary tools and materials you’ll need, as well as the step-by-step process for applying and removing Tesla PPF.

    Pre-Application Preparation

    Before applying the paint protection film, it’s essential to clean the surface of your Tesla vehicle. Start by washing the car using a mild soap and water solution to remove any dirt or debris. Then, use a microfiber cloth to dry the surface, paying extra attention to areas with excessive dust or debris accumulation. Additionally, remove any protective film or wax from the paint surface. Finally, use a clay bar to remove any contaminants or imperfections from the paint.

    Step-by-Step Application Process

    Here’s a step-by-step guide on how to apply paint protection film to your Tesla vehicle:

    1. Prepare the surface: Follow the pre-application preparation steps Artikeld above.
    2. Measure and cut the film: Measure the area where you’ll be applying the film, and use a template or guide to ensure accurate cutting.
    3. Remove the backing: Carefully remove the backing from the film, taking note of any instructions for alignment and application.
    4. Apply the film: Starting from the center, apply the film to the surface, smoothing out any air pockets or bubbles.
    5. Trim excess film: Use a trimmer or utility knife to remove excess film around the edges.
    6. Inspect and adjust: Inspect the film for any bubbles or imperfections, and make adjustments as needed.

    Factors Influencing PPF Prices

    Several factors can influence the price of custom PPF designs, including:

    • Material quality: Higher-quality materials, such as thicker films or those made from more durable materials, tend to cost more.
    • Design complexity: Custom designs with intricate patterns or unique layouts can be more expensive to produce.
    • Manufacturer reputation: Reputable manufacturers may charge more for their products due to the quality and expertise involved.
    • Application process: More complex applications, such as those involving curved surfaces or unusual shapes, may require specialized equipment and expertise, increasing the cost.

    It’s essential to consider these factors when selecting a custom PPF design for your Tesla, as the final price can vary significantly depending on the details of your chosen design.

    Essential FAQs

    What are the benefits of Tesla PPF?

    Tesla PPF offers various benefits, including improved durability, enhanced appearance, reduced maintenance costs, and preservation of resale value.

    Can I apply Tesla PPF myself?

    While it’s possible to apply PPF yourself, we recommend professional installation for optimal results and to ensure proper adhesion.

    How long does Tesla PPF last?

    Tesla PPF can last up to 10 years or more, depending on various factors, including weather conditions and maintenance practices.

    Can I customize my Tesla PPF?

    Yes, many manufacturers offer customization options, allowing you to choose from various patterns, designs, and colors to match your vehicle’s unique style.
